I went to the Dept of Motor Vehicles to renew my drivers license which will expire on my birthday. They guy attending to me asked, "So what will you be doing on your birthday?" I'm sure he initiates a lot of conversations with that question.
"I'll be in Kenya," I responded, which is not quite true, since I will come home in time to celebrate my birthday with family, but it was the first thing that popped into my head.
He asked a few questions about what I'd be doing there and the wildlife, which I answered enthusiastically. Then he asked, "So will they give you a hat?"
"A hat? No, I'll have to bring my own hat, but you are right that it is important to wear one for protection from the sun."
He finished up my paperwork, took my $34, and sent me on my way with the comment, "Too bad you don't get a hat, but have a nice time anyway."
I'm hoping to have a very nice time, and with luck, some more nice times between now and when my license expires again 8 years from now. My hat is packed.
